Mr. Dalton, I have read a lot of you on this site already, so I'm a little intimidated to ask you, "are you sure?"

I have a 1995 e320 Sedan. My understanding is that it is a 124, and the codes I used are from another Thread, saying #2 is the Heated Oxygen Sensor, #4 Air Injection System faulty hot film mass air flow sensor with hot wire, and #26 Upshift Delay Faulty.

This was read off a 16-code box (indicates 124?) with the reset and little light, by pins 2 and 4 (if I recall correctly) right by my battery, as you told me in an earlier response. I cycled this 3 times to be sure my reading was correct, and each time it was 2, 4, then 26.

So, when I look up the part on-line and calling parts stores, both indicate that there is an upstream and downstream sensor? Some even said, front and back.
